Notably, hiNs containing both RIN3 mutations (RQPS) showed a highly significant elevation in active RAB5* levels ( n = 3, P = 0.003) compared to the R427Q mutation, possibly synergistically, in the presence of the P477S mutation.

Notably, in an analysis of a multiethnic dataset with unrelated AD cases and controls from the Alzheimer’s disease sequencing project (ADSP; Table 1 ), rs74074811 showed nominally significant association of these same two RIN3 mutations with AD risk in the Hispanic population ( P = 0.035).

In contrast, the increase in RAB5* levels in cells containing only the RIN3 (PS) mutation was modest and did not reach statistical significance ( n = 3, P = 0.076).
